Transponder Keys

This is a key that has embedded microchip. The chip emits signals when it's close to the ignition that activates it. This makes it impossible for anyone else without the original key to start your car, aiding in stopping auto theft.

The microchip has a digital serial number that authenticates the key to the vehicle. When the key is near the ignition, the microchip transmits an low-level radio signal to a specific receiver inside the car. It then sends a signal to the engine control unit (ECU) to turn on the ignition and start the car.

Key fobs are not only a security tool but can be used to unlock your doors and open the windows and sunroof. It is also able to switch off the immobilizer which disables the engine of your car when the key is removed from the ignition.

Some of the more complex varieties of keys that are chip-based have different levels of security. The VATS key from GM has an anti-theft feature that stops the car from starting in the event of using the wrong key. This is accomplished by having an additional resistor in the key which has one of 15 possible resistances to be preset.

Smart Key Replacement

smart car keys replacement keys are available in a variety of newer vehicles. They can unlock doors and start engines, as well as perform other functions without the driver having to touch or hold their key fob. These keys work by communicating with antennas in the car that recognize an individual signal from the key fob.

The primary benefit of a smart car key is its convenience. It makes it less necessary for drivers to fiddle with their keys while pulling out of the driveway and could cause them to lock themselves out. It also makes entering and starting the vehicle a lot more efficient because it doesn't require you to find and push buttons on a traditional remote.

A smart key also provides an additional level of security. While other key fobs can emit the same frequency signal as yours smart car key case keys emit a unique encrypted signal, making it more difficult for tech-savvy thieves to identify and utilize a copy of your car's signal.
